Zenit thrash Spartak to keep tabs on leaders CSKA

-

MOSCOW: Reigning champions Zenit St Petersburg beat Spartak Moscow 5-2 on Saturday to close in on leaders CSKA Moscow, who were held 1-1 by city rivals Lokomotiv.

Zenit are now second in the Russian Premier League, one point behind CSKA, while Rostov, who meet Kuban Krasnodar on Sunday, sit third one point further back.

“Perhaps we were a bit nervous in the first half because of the chance that the draw between CSKA and Lokomotiv gave us,” Zenit manager Andre Villas-Boas said.

“We didn’t come with the same concentrat­ion and we suffered a little bit in the first half.

“But in the second we tried to add some confidence to our players. They were in a good period after four wins and we tried to calm them down a little bit to put everything in place. And it helped us to achieve this unbelievab­le result.”

Madrid have eaten into Barca’s massive lead at the top of the table thanks to a run of seven straight wins, whilst the Catalans have taken just one point from their last nine.

“Today I wouldn’t sign for that,” said Zidane when asked if he would settle for winning Madrid’s 11th Champions League at the expense of La Liga.

“We need to keep going until the end of the season.”

Madrid will face Manchester City in the Champions League semi-finals after a rousing comeback to beat Wolfsburg 3-2 on aggregate in midweek thanks to a Cristiano Ronaldo hat-trick.

Ronaldo was on target once more with his 47th goal of the season to round off the scoring, but it was Karim Benzema who shone just days after it was confirmed he will not take part at Euro 2016.

The French Football Federation announced on Wednesday that Benzema will not be available for selection due to his role in a sex-tape blackmail plot against fellow French internatio­nal Mathieu Valbuena.

Zidane had called on Benzema not to let his head drop for the remainder of the season and he responded by sweeping home the opening goal to register his best ever scoring season in La Liga with 22.

Benzema then teed up Isco and Gareth Bale either side of half-time before late goals from James Rodriguez and Ronaldo put the seal on another comprehens­ive win for Zidane’s men.

“It did affect him and yes he is disappoint­ed, but he is a profession­al and he knows that on the field he is very important for the team,” Zidane said of his compatriot Benzema.

“Today he scored and had two assists, so he is very concentrat­ed on what he is doing.”

Barcelona can regain their four-point lead over Madrid at the top with victory over Valencia on Sunday. - AFP
